One section meets on site at the location listed; and one section meets online only.An intriguing fly-by of the foundational civilizations, in this course we will examine the basic institutions, how they interacted with each other, their use of the military and weaponry, religious beliefs and sciences. Mesopotamia; Egypt; Harappan India; Xia, Shang, and Zhou China; Olmec and other civilizations with be covered. How did these civilizations influence our own? Join us and find out!
